我在mysql中执行了以下查询,发现错误.任何人都可以在mysql syntex中识别错误.
INSERT INTO order values('2014-12-07','1','1',12,12,'1',12,'2014-12-07',-34)
Run Code Online (Sandbox Code Playgroud)
order 是关键字,因此您需要将其括在引号中:
INSERT INTO `order` values('2014-12-07','1','1',12,12,'1',12,'2014-12-07',-34)
Run Code Online (Sandbox Code Playgroud)
您还应该指定order要插入值的表的列以避免歧义:
INSERT INTO `order` (col1, col2, ...) values('2014-12-07','1','1',12,12,'1',12,'2014-12-07',-34)
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
46 次 |
| 最近记录: |